Home System Trading Post

Master Multi-Timeframe Trading with Stochastic and Bollinger Bands in MT4

Attachments
58746.zip (1.43 KB, Download 0 times)

Hey there, fellow traders! If you're looking to enhance your trading strategy on MetaTrader 4, you might want to check out this multi-timeframe EA that harnesses the power of the Stochastic Oscillator and Bollinger Bands. Let’s dive into what makes this tool a must-have on your trading desk!

Key Features:

  • Multi-Timeframe Analysis: This EA analyzes Stochastic Oscillator and Bollinger Bands values from M1, M5, and M15 charts, providing you with robust trade entry signals.
  • Entry Conditions:
    • Buy Signal: All three Stochastic K lines need to be below the MinStochOversold level, while the M15 price is hanging below the lower Bollinger Band.
    • Sell Signal: Conversely, for a sell, all three Stochastic K lines should be above the MaxStochOverbought level, with the M15 price sitting above the upper Bollinger Band.
  • Trade Management:
    • It limits the number of trades you can have open at once, adhering to the MaxTradesPerTrend setting.
    • Stop Loss (SL) and Take Profit (TP) levels are intelligently calculated using the Average True Range (ATR) from the M15 timeframe, alongside your SLMultiplier and TPMultiplier inputs.
  • Spread Control: The EA checks the current spread against MaxSpreadStandard (ideal for standard/ECN accounts) and MaxSpreadCent (for cent/micro accounts). If the spread is too wide, it uses buy limit or sell limit orders instead of jumping in with instant execution.
  • Pending Orders: When the market spread is less than ideal for immediate trades, the EA sets pending buy limit or sell limit orders just below the current price for buys and just above for sells.
  • Input Flexibility: Customize the EA to fit your trading style with various parameters, including slippage, lot size, indicator settings, SL/TP multipliers, break-even and trailing stop options, maximum spread limits, and Stochastic overbought/oversold levels.
  • OnTick Function: The OnTick() function acts as the main engine, retrieving indicator values, checking for open orders, and evaluating conditions to potentially trigger new trades.
  • Debugging Tools: This EA includes handy Print() statements for debugging, allowing you to log Stochastic K values across timeframes and monitor the current spread.
Multi-Timeframe EA Trading Strategy

Give this EA a shot and see how it can help refine your trading strategy. Remember, the market is always evolving, so stay adaptable and keep learning!

Related Posts

Comments (0)